pixy2:实时图像识别的利器,轻松驾驭视觉项目
pixy2 项目地址: https://gitcode.com/gh_mirrors/pi/pixy2
项目介绍
在当今科技飞速发展的时代,图像识别技术已经渗透到我们生活的方方面面,从智能监控到无人驾驶,从医疗诊断到智能制造。而在这个领域中,pixy2以其出色的性能和简单的使用方法,成为了一个备受瞩目的开源项目。pixy2是一个用于实时图像识别和颜色追踪的设备,它能够快速、准确地识别和跟踪指定的颜色或物体。
项目技术分析
pixy2的核心技术是基于其硬件和软件的协同工作。项目包含了以下几个关键部分:
-
硬件部分:pixy2的硬件包括一个CMOS图像传感器和一个32位微控制器。这些硬件组件使得pixy2能够实时处理图像数据,并快速做出响应。
-
软件部分:软件部分分为设备端(src/device)和主机端(src/host)。设备端的代码负责处理图像数据,执行颜色识别和追踪算法;主机端的代码则负责与设备端通信,接收处理结果,并在主机上执行进一步的处理。
-
编译脚本:scripts目录下的脚本负责编译和构建pixy2的软件模块,使得用户能够轻松地在不同操作系统上部署和使用pixy2。
项目及技术应用场景
pixy2的应用场景非常广泛,以下是一些典型的使用案例:
-
智能机器人导航:pixy2可以实时识别和跟踪地面上的特定标记,帮助机器人进行自主导航。
-
无人机飞行控制:无人机可以使用pixy2进行视觉定位,即使在复杂环境下也能够保持稳定的飞行。
-
智能制造:在生产线中,pixy2可以用于识别和分类不同的物体,提高生产效率。
-
智能监控:pixy2可以用于实时监控特定颜色的物体,如交通监控中的车辆识别。
-
教育与研究:pixy2的简单易用和开源特性使其成为教育领域和科研项目的理想选择。
项目特点
pixy2之所以能够在众多图像识别项目中脱颖而出,主要得益于以下几个特点:
-
实时性能:pixy2能够在不到100毫秒的时间内处理图像数据,并输出结果,这在需要快速响应的应用场景中至关重要。
-
易于集成:pixy2提供了丰富的接口和示例代码,用户可以轻松地将pixy2集成到自己的项目中。
-
开源特性:pixy2的源代码完全开源,用户可以根据自己的需求进行定制和优化。
-
社区支持:pixy2有一个活跃的社区,用户可以在这里找到丰富的教程、示例代码和解决问题的方法。
-
兼容性强:pixy2支持Windows、Linux和Mac等多种操作系统,使得它能够适应各种开发环境。
总之,pixy2是一个功能强大、应用广泛的实时图像识别项目。无论您是机器人开发人员、无人机爱好者,还是智能制造领域的工程师,pixy2都能为您提供强大的支持。开源的特性使得您能够自由地探索和定制,发挥无限创意。选择pixy2,让您的图像识别项目更加高效、准确!